Championing Leadership Development
New FEDA YIL Co-Chairs Alex Lu and Meghan Hurst share their leadership experiences and advise young professionals looking to make an impact.
F
ounded in 2018, FEDA Young Industry Leaders (YIL) seeks to identify and develop talented
individuals who are making key contributions and furthering the business goals of the association’s distributor and manufacturer members. The group engages young professionals through leadership development training and by providing opportunities for them to network with their peers and learn directly from top leaders within the foodservice equipment and supplies industry. The association recently welcomed two new FEDA YIL co-chairs, who
will help support these goals. A past FEDA YIL Steering Committee member, Alex Lu is the president of Restaurant Equipment Market, an Atlanta-based dealer that operates a 20,000-square-foot retail store and a 150,000-square-foot warehouse facility. Joining him as co-chair is Meghan Hurst, the vice president and general manager for Vulcan, an ITW Food Equipment Group company. The following Q&A covers Lu and
Hurst’s own leadership experiences and why they believe other young professionals can benefi t from being involved in FEDA YIL.
